Petra Hobisch‐Hagen is a scholar working on Biochemistry,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ine and Hematology. According to data from OpenAlex, Petra Hobisch‐Hagen has authored 19 papers receiving a total of 520 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Biochemistry, 8 papers in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ine and 5 papers in Hematology. Recurrent topics in Petra Hobisch‐Hagen’s work include Blood transfusion and management (9 papers), Trauma, Hemostasis, Coagulopathy, Resuscitation (7 papers) and Venous Thromboembolism Diagnosis and Management (3 papers). Petra Hobisch‐Hagen is often cited by papers focused on Blood transfusion and management (9 papers), Trauma, Hemostasis, Coagulopathy, Resuscitation (7 papers) and Venous Thromboembolism Diagnosis and Management (3 papers). Petra Hobisch‐Hagen collaborates with scholars based in Austria, Germany and United States. Petra Hobisch‐Hagen's co-authors include Wolfgang Schobersberger, Dietmar Fuchs, Franz J. Wiedermann, Wolfgang Jelkmann, Petra Innerhofer, D Friès, Andreas Mayr, Walter Nußbaumer, Antón Klingler and Manfred Herold and has published in prestigious journals such as FEBS Letters, Critical Care Medicine and The Journal of Pathology.
